Breaking Down Barriers: How Deep Learning Models Are Making Complex Problems Solvable

In recent years, deep learning models have made significant advancements in solving complex problems that were once thought to be unsolvable. These models, which are a type of artificial intelligence that mimics the way the human brain processes information, have the ability to analyze vast amounts of data and extract patterns, making them ideal for tackling challenging tasks in various fields such as healthcare, finance, and transportation.

One of the key advantages of deep learning models is their ability to break down barriers that have traditionally hindered progress in solving complex problems. For example, in the field of healthcare, deep learning models have been used to analyze medical images and identify patterns that can help diagnose diseases such as cancer at an early stage. This has the potential to significantly improve patient outcomes and reduce healthcare costs.

In the financial sector, deep learning models have been used to predict stock market trends and identify fraudulent transactions, helping to make more accurate investment decisions and prevent financial fraud. In the transportation sector, deep learning models have been used to improve traffic management systems and optimize route planning, leading to more efficient transportation networks and reduced congestion.

One of the key reasons why deep learning models are so effective at solving complex problems is their ability to learn from vast amounts of data. By training these models on large datasets, they can identify patterns and relationships that may not be immediately apparent to human analysts. This allows them to make more accurate predictions and decisions, leading to better outcomes in a wide range of applications.

Despite their impressive capabilities, deep learning models are not without their challenges. For example, they can be computationally expensive to train and require large amounts of data to perform effectively. Additionally, there are concerns about the ethical implications of using these models, such as bias in decision-making or invasion of privacy.
